Electrical Panel Upgrade Cost in Tulsa 2026
Electrical Panel Upgrade in Tulsa costs between $1,365 and $5,460 in 2026, with the average around $2,730. Tulsa pricing runs 9% below the US national average. Replacement of the main electrical panel with a new higher amperage service, breakers, and grounding to meet current code. Includes utility coordination and inspection.

What changes the price of electrical panel upgrade in Tulsa
- New amperage 100 to 200
- Panel location and access
- Utility mast and meter work
- Grounding upgrades
- Permits and inspection

Tulsa permits for electrical panel upgrade
Building department: City of Tulsa Development Services Department, Permit Center. https://www.cityoftulsa.org/government/departments/development-services/
Typical permit cost: $100 - $1,500 residential. Inspection time: 5 to 12 business days. Tulsa rule: Tulsa Development Services runs permitting, plan review, and inspections through the Accela-based Tulsa Online Permits system. Oklahoma licenses plumbing, electrical, and mechanical trades at the state level while leaving general contracting unlicensed, so trade contractors must carry state trade licenses.
Oklahoma sales tax and licensing for Electrical
Oklahoma sales tax: 4.5% + local (~8.9% combined avg). Real property labor exempt. Local sales tax varies widely city to city.
State license: Oklahoma Construction Industries Board (electrical, plumbing, mechanical only), no statewide license, local registration required.
